Cheers to McGillin's: Philly's Oldest Tavern won honorable mention from the Pennsylvania Press Club, affiliate of the National Federation of Press Women.McGillin’s Olde Ale House is the oldest continuously operating tavern in Philadelphia and one of the oldest in the country. The historic tavern’s colorful history includes romances, celebrities, ghosts, and a tale of survival through the Civil War, two world wars, Prohibition, a fire, and two pandemics. Opening in 1860—the year Abraham Lincoln was elected—McGillin’s is an iconic Philadelphia institution. This book solidifies the owners’ mission to carefully preserve McGillin’s unique historic legacy by chronicling the most enduring tales of McGillin’s from the late 1800s through today. Cheers to McGillin’s contains many never-before-published photos, along with plenty of great food and drink recipes from its bar and kitchen. Whether in happy times—first dates, marriages, anniversaries, Eagles games—or tragic moments like 9/11 or the bombing of Pearl Harbor, McGillin’s has been there to celebrate and mourn, sharing common experiences with Philadelphians from all walks of life.McGillin’s has been owned by just two families for the past 165 years. The McGillins (an Irish couple who raised their thirteen children upstairs) and their descendants ran the pub for ninety-eight years. Then the Spaniak / Shepaniak / Mullins family took over and have owned the tavern since 1958—three generations and counting. Read more
